  • Who is Georgie Davis?

  • He was an armed robber in the UK that was released based on the witnesses being unreliable.. he had a campaign, ran by friends, for his release essentially..saying he was innocent and the eyewitnesses were not reliable. Shortly after he was released he went back to jail for one or two more armed robberies
